Some homes survive the decades... others are honoured by them. Say hello to 41 Toronto Street - a remarkable century home in Guelph's historic St. Patrick's Ward, where timeless character has been thoughtfully preserved while embracing every modern convenience. Reimagined from top to bottom by a skilled builder, with over $200,000 invested in recent improvements, this is the best of yesterday and today. Gorgeous pine floors, rosette crown moulding and carefully selected period-inspired finishes honour the home's history, while a beautifully renovated kitchen featuring a striking natural stone feature wall and iconic Elmira range blends old-world charm with modern function.The spacious main-floor primary suite offers a walk-in closet with laundry and a luxurious five-piece spa bath with a soaker tub and oversized double rain shower. A fully self-contained one-bedroom in-law suite with its own entrance and laundry provides exceptional flexibility for extended family, guests or income potential. Outside, professionally landscaped grounds create a private retreat with low-maintenance perennial gardens, flagstone and interlock patios, a wood deck, filtered chlorinated plunge pool and gated driveway with ample parking. The oversized 21' x 28' detached double garage is equipped with 240-amp service and its own heat pump, making it ideal for hobbyists, creatives or a workshop.Just a short stroll to Guelph's beloved cafés, restaurants, boutiques and farmers' market, this is a rare opportunity to own a beautifully restored piece of the city's history in one of its most cherished neighbourhoods.
